Small handheld spraying device

By incorporating components such as protective plates, metal troughs, and magnetic strips into a small handheld spraying device, the problem of material splashing during spraying is solved, achieving protection during the spraying process and stability of the material bottle, thus improving the safety and stability of use.

Abstract

The utility model relates to the technical field of handheld spraying devices, and discloses a small handheld spraying device which comprises a spraying body, a spraying head is installed on one side of the spraying body, a spraying hole is formed in the spraying head, a handle is installed on one side of the bottom end of the spraying body, and an anti-skid pad is installed on the outer side wall of the handle. A base is installed at the bottom end of the handle, a protection plate is installed at the top end of the magnetic strip, a bottle base is installed on the other side of the bottom end of the spraying body, and a material bottle is installed at the bottom end of the bottle base. When the handheld spraying device disclosed by the utility model is held by hand to spray an object, the components such as the protective plate, the metal groove, the metal seat and the magnetic strip are arranged, so that the protective plate can be conveniently and quickly mounted on the handheld spraying device, and the protective plate can shield and protect splashed materials when the spraying device sprays the materials; and the materials are prevented from being splashed to the arms of the user, and the spraying device has certain protection performance.

Technical Field

[0001] This utility model relates to the technical field of handheld spraying devices, specifically a small handheld spraying device. Background Technology

[0002] The small handheld sprayer is a portable spraying tool used for spraying paint onto the surfaces of various objects. When using it, the user holds the sprayer in their hand and aims it at the item to be sprayed. It is suitable for indoor, detailed, and small item spraying. It features simple operation, portability, and wide applicability.

[0003] Traditional small handheld sprayers often cause material to splatter during use, lacking proper protection and easily getting onto the user's arms and causing dirt. Therefore, we propose a small handheld sprayer to address these issues. Utility Model Content

[0004] The purpose of this invention is to provide a small handheld spraying device to solve the problems mentioned in the background art.

[0005] To achieve the above objectives, this utility model provides the following technical solution: a small handheld spraying device, comprising a spraying body, a nozzle mounted on one side of the spraying body, the nozzle having spray holes inside, a handle mounted on one side of the bottom of the spraying body, an anti-slip pad mounted on the outer wall of the handle, a base mounted on the bottom of the handle, a wire mounted on one side of the base, a metal groove mounted on the outer wall of one side of the nozzle, a metal seat mounted inside the metal groove, a magnetic strip movably mounted inside the metal seat, a protective plate mounted on the top of the magnetic strip, and a bottle holder mounted on the other side of the bottom of the spraying body, with a material bottle mounted on the bottom of the bottle holder.

[0006] As a further technical solution of this utility model, the spray holes are provided in a plurality of manner, and the plurality of spray holes are distributed in a ring at equal intervals inside the nozzle.

[0007] As a further technical solution of this utility model, the cross-section of the magnetic strip is smaller than the cross-section of the metal groove, and the magnetic strip and the metal groove form an engaging structure.

[0008] As a further technical solution of this utility model, elastic straps are fixed to both sides of the bottle holder by fasteners. The bottom of each elastic strap is provided with a fixing hole, and a fixing buckle is movably provided inside each fixing hole. One side of the fixing buckle is fixed to the outer wall of the material bottle.

[0009] As a further technical solution of this utility model, the elastic straps are provided in two sets, and the two sets of elastic straps are symmetrically distributed about the central axis of the material bottle.

[0010] As a further technical solution of this utility model, a mounting groove is provided at the bottom of one side of the handle, a mounting seat is installed inside the mounting groove, a connecting block is installed on one side of the mounting seat, and a fixing block is installed inside the connecting block by hinge through a shaft. A rubber wristband is installed on one side of the fixing block, magic raw hair is installed on one side of one end of the rubber wristband, and magic barbs are installed on the other side of one end of the rubber wristband.

[0011] As a further technical solution of this utility model, the outer side wall of the mounting base is uniformly provided with external threads, the inner side wall of the mounting groove is uniformly provided with internal threads, and the mounting base and the mounting groove form a threaded connection.

[0012] As a further technical solution of this utility model, the magic bristles and the original magic bristles have the same width, and the magic bristles and the original magic bristles form an adhesive structure.

[0013] Compared with the prior art, the beneficial effects of this utility model are: this small handheld spraying device not only has a certain protective structure and realizes the limiting and binding of the material bottle, but also prevents the paint device from being damaged by slipping and falling.

[0014] (1) When the handheld spraying device is used to spray the item, it is equipped with components such as a protective plate, metal groove, metal base and magnetic strip. This allows the handheld spraying device to be easily and quickly installed with a protective plate. The protective plate can block and protect the material that splashes out when the spraying device is spraying the material, and prevent the material from splashing onto the user's arm, thus realizing that the spraying device has a certain degree of protection.

[0015] (2) By setting components such as fasteners, elastic straps, fasteners and fastening holes, the material bottle will be installed with paint inside and then installed at the bottom of the bottle holder when in use. When installing the material bottle, it is necessary to ensure that the material bottle is stably installed at the bottom of the bottle holder for use, so that the material bottle is not easy to loosen or fall off during use, and ensures the stability of paint delivery inside the material bottle during use.

[0016] (3) By setting up components such as rubber wristband, magic barbs and magic raw hair, the user needs to ensure the stability of holding the spraying device when using it. If the hand slips, the spraying device will slip and be damaged. Because of the above components, the spraying device is not easy to fall if the hand slips during the process of holding it, and has the effect of preventing drop. Attached Figure Description

[0023] Please see Figure 1-4 This utility model provides an embodiment: a small handheld spraying device, including a spraying body 1, a nozzle 3 mounted on one side of the spraying body 1, and a spray hole 25 provided inside the nozzle 3; a handle 10 mounted on one side of the bottom end of the spraying body 1, and an anti-slip pad 11 mounted on the outer side wall of the handle 10; a base 16 mounted on the bottom end of the handle 10, and a wire 15 mounted on one side of the base 16; a metal groove 22 mounted on the outer side wall of one side of the nozzle 3, and a metal seat 23 provided inside the metal groove 22. The internal moving part is equipped with a magnetic strip 24, and a protective plate 2 is installed on the top of the magnetic strip 24. A bottle holder 9 is installed on the other side of the bottom of the spray body 1, and a material bottle 6 is installed at the bottom of the bottle holder 9. Several spray holes 25 are provided, and the several spray holes 25 are distributed in a ring at equal intervals inside the spray head 3, so that the paint is sprayed out evenly. The cross-section of the magnetic strip 24 is smaller than the cross-section of the metal groove 22. The magnetic strip 24 and the metal groove 22 form a locking structure, which facilitates the installation and removal of the protective plate 2, making it more convenient to use.

[0024] Specifically, such as Figure 1 and Figure 4 As shown, when using this spraying device, the protective plate 2 can be taken out and its bottom magnetic strip 24 can be aligned with the metal seat 23 inside the metal groove 22 and locked together, so that the magnetic strip 24 and the metal groove 22 are magnetically attracted together, thereby installing the protective plate 2 on the outer wall of the nozzle 3 for protection. When the paint is sprayed from the spray hole 25 inside the nozzle 3, the paint can be prevented from splashing onto the user's arm.

[0025] Both sides of the bottle holder 9 are fixed with elastic straps 5 by fasteners 4. The bottom of the elastic straps 5 is provided with fixing holes 8. Fixing buckles 7 are movably installed inside the fixing holes 8. One side of the fixing buckles 7 is fixed to the outer wall of the material bottle 6. There are two sets of elastic straps 5. The two sets of elastic straps 5 are symmetrically distributed about the central axis of the material bottle 6, which has a better limiting and reinforcement effect on the material bottle 6.

[0026] Specifically, such as Figure 1 and Figure 2 As shown, the rubber wristband 12 is wrapped around the user's arm, so that the magic bristles 13 and the magic raw hair 14 are stuck together. If the user slips while using the spraying device by holding the handle 10, the rubber wristband 12 will still be wrapped around the user's arm to pull the spraying device, which can prevent the spraying device from falling and being damaged. When the rubber wristband 12 is not needed, the mounting base 21 can be rotated to move it out of the mounting groove 17 inside the handle 10, thereby removing the rubber wristband 12.

[0027] A mounting groove 17 is provided at the bottom of one side of the handle 10. A mounting seat 21 is installed inside the mounting groove 17. A connecting block 20 is installed on one side of the mounting seat 21. A fixing block 18 is hinged inside the connecting block 20 through a shaft 19. A rubber wristband 12 is installed on one side of the fixing block 18. Magic bristles 14 are installed on one side of one end of the rubber wristband 12. Magic barbs 13 are installed on the other side of one end of the rubber wristband 12. External threads are evenly provided on the outer side wall of the mounting seat 21. Internal threads are evenly provided on the inner side wall of the mounting groove 17. The mounting seat 21 and the mounting groove 17 form a threaded connection. The threaded connection design facilitates the disassembly and assembly of the connecting block 20, thereby facilitating the disassembly and assembly of the rubber wristband 12. The magic barbs 13 and magic bristles 14 have the same width and form an adhesive structure, which facilitates the fixing and opening of the rubber wristband 12.

[0028] Specifically, such as Figure 1 and Figure 3As shown, after the material bottle 6 and the bottle holder 9 are assembled together, the elastic straps 5 on both sides of the bottle holder 9 are pulled in sequence so that the fixing hole 8 at the bottom of the bottle holder 9 is fastened to the fixing buckle 7 corresponding to the outer side wall of the material bottle 6. Thus, the elastic straps 5 are installed on both sides of the material bottle 6, so that the material bottle 6 and the bottle holder 9 are stably installed together and are not easy to fall off during subsequent use.

[0029] Working principle: When using this utility model, take the material bottle 6, fill it with paint, and install it together with the bottle holder 9. After the material bottle 6 and the bottle holder 9 are assembled, pull the elastic straps 5 on both sides of the bottle holder 9 in sequence so that the fixing hole 8 at the bottom is fastened to the fixing buckle 7 corresponding to the outer wall of the material bottle 6 to reinforce the material bottle 6. Then take the protective plate 2 and align the magnetic strip 24 at the bottom with the metal seat 23 inside the metal groove 22 and lock it together so that the magnetic strip 24 and the metal groove 22 are magnetically attracted together, thereby installing the protective plate 2 on the outer wall of the spray head 3 for protection. Next, wrap the rubber wristband 12 around the user's arm so that the magic bristles 13 and the magic raw hair 14 are attached together, and put the rubber wristband 12 on the user's arm. Then hold the handle 10 and take the spraying device to the position to be used, aim it at the item to be sprayed, and connect the power supply through the cable 15 to start the spraying work.
